Pedestrian injured by vehicle near highway intersection, Valparaiso IN

According to the dispatch call, a male pedestrian was hit by a vehicle near the intersection of East U.S. Highway 6 and North State Road 49 bypass. He was conscious and talking but appeared to have a head injury. Emergency fire and medical units responded to the scene.
